What Causes Bump On Outside Of Vagina?

I popped a bump I had notice on the outside of the vagina and Yellow substance came out , then blood come out and lastly white substance came out but there is still a hard bump there I dont know whether I should continue to pop it or not because I became disgusted! Do you have any Idea what type of bump it is?

General & Family Physician 's  Response
Hello ma'am and welcome.

The bump could have been a simple infection or could even be related to sexually transmitted infections. I would have prefered you not to pop the bump, but as you habe already done so. Makse sure you keep the area clean and dry, try to take sitz baths with epsom salt and also apply several warm compresses to the region.

It would be best to meet a doctor and get diagnosed and accordingly treated.
